Senior Product Manager
The Senior Product Manager role should be able to flex between multiple roles:
Product Owner, Project Manager, QA, UX Designer, Researcher, and Consultant. He/She will be responsible for managing client development initiatives, leading requirements gathering, prioritizing the product backlog with client input, testing the product, and partnering with the Engineering Manager to deliver on the client engagement.
